New tax on shell companies could help the US shrink its $40 trillion federal debt

The US federal debt has hit $40 trillion, while the Treasury Department announced it will no longer require shell companies to disclose their owners. A new tax on such companies could help Washington reduce its deficit, the article argues. The decision to drop ownership disclosure requirements is seen as a step backwards in the fight against tax avoidance.
